trees the house had always been at the edge of the wood where the trees stopped apologizing for their density and simply became a wall. Goldilocks had not been looking for a house. She hadn't been looking for anything at all. She had simply been walking as she had every morning since she could remember and the path just ended here. The door was
unlocked. This wasn't surprising. She didn't ask herself why it wasn't. Inside three bowls sat on the table. The first one burned her tongue. The second set her teeth together with cold, but the third the third was exactly right, and she ate every spoonful without even tasting it. Watching the steam from the
two hot ball dissipate in a pattern that looked almost like language along curling sentence she couldn't read before it dissolved. She moved through the house the way someone moves through a place they've been before without knowing they've been there. The chairs were right where she expected them to be. The stairs had the right number of steps. The room smelled like something
she couldn't name but recognized as the smell of safety, which she had always been told was the smell of home. She found the chairs. One was too big, one was too small, and one the one that broke under her. She felt it giving way a half second before it did. Not because she was braced for it, but because some
part of her body had registered, at the exact moment she sat down, that it was calibrated to fail at precisely her weight. She went upstairs to the beds. The first was too hard, and her spine knew the wrongness of it before her mind even did. The second was to soft and she sank into it with a sensation like being
measured. And then the third bed. It was exactly right. The blankets were the precise weight her shoulders wanted. The pillow held her neck at just the angle that released the tension she always carried there. The tension she had never mentioned to anyone. She thought, "I have never been this comfortable." She thought, "No one has ever been this
comfortable." Then a chilling thought. This is what it would feel like if something knew my body better than I do. And then she slept. In her dream, the house had no walls, only scaffolding where the walls should have been. And behind the scaffolding, technicians in pale gray uniforms moved between stations with clipboards, making notes.
In the dream, she could see herself sleeping in the third bed, surrounded by instruments she had no names for. They weren't measuring her pulse or her breathing. They were measuring something that existed in no language she spoke. One technician looked up and saw her watching him. He didn't look alarmed at all. He just looked down at his
clipboard and made a note. She woke to the sound of the front door opening. Three bears came in. She understood later when there was time to understand anything that they had never really been bears. They wore the shape of bears the way a tool wears the shape of its function. They weren't bears, but the shape of a bear was the precise form
needed to generate the required response. A threat, but not a credible threat, something between danger and absurdity, something that would make her run, and she ran. The window she chose opened onto a path that led toward home. and she understood even as she ran that she had been predicted to choose this exact window. Her preference for
right-facing exits had been noted across 14 prior iterations of this same scenario. The other windows, she realized opened onto different paths with different destinations, all for different profiles. At the edge of the wood, where her path met the familiar world, she stopped. There was a folder sitting on a tree stump. Her name was on
the tab written in a hand she didn't recognize. She opened it. Inside was a document dated the day she was born. A complete physiological and psychological profile. It listed her temperature tolerances, her pressure thresholds, the exact neck angle at which she stopped
carrying tension. her predicted response to a too hot bowl, a too cold bowl, a chair engineered to fail at a calculated moment of lowered alertness. Her preference for right-facing exits documented across all previous iterations. The last entry was dated today. It read, "Subject will stop at
the woods edge. Subject will find this folder. Subject will read to the end. She looked at the final line." It said, "Subject will look up now toward the house one last time." She looked up. The windows of the house were lit from within. A figure stood in one of them, a technician. He raised a hand. She
couldn't tell if it was a greeting or a measurement. The distinction, she was beginning to understand, had never mattered to the study. She walked home. The path was exactly the right length. The porridge waiting for her on her mother's table was warm. Exactly. Right. She sat down and ate without asking who
had made it or how they had known when she was coming or why all her life everything made for her had fit so perfectly. Comfort is not the absence of danger. It is the most refined form of it. The version calibrated so precisely to your body that you never feel the seams. The house was built for you
before you were you. The only question worth asking is how many times you a walked that path believing you were unlooking for anything at all and what exactly gets filed away when you find it. Thank you for listening. If this story made you think, consider subscribing for more tales that look
